Facebook's IPO was the biggest tech IPO at the time. The company founded by Mark Zuckerberg and a few of his Harvard classmates resisted takeover attempts for years.

We prepared an interesting Case Study that will examine Facebook's IPO from an interesting perspective. In this video, we'll try to answer questions such as:

How important was the timing of Facebook's IPO?
What were the challenges ahead of the company at the time of the IPO?
Why investors wanted to get in on Facebook's IPO?
How investment bankers determined the price of Facebook shares and whether they under or over valued the company.
